Nearly 140 FDNY Firefighters Battle 3-Alarm Blaze

Two FDNY firefighters were among seven people injured in a blaze that broke out on the fifth floor of a Manhattan apartment building Thursday.
May 8, 2020

At least seven people were injured in a three-alarm fire that broke out on the fifth floor of a Manhattan apartment building Thursday.

FDNY crews—33 units and 138 firefighters—arrived at the West 101st Street building just before 4 p.m., the West Side Rag reports. The blaze started on the building's fifth floor and spread to the sixth and seventh floors.

At least two FDNY firefighters and five civilians were injured. None of the injuries was considered life-threatening.

Firefighters had the blaze under control shortly before 5:25 p.m.
